Kathy Overton is a scholar working on Ecology, Immunology and Oceanography. According to data from OpenAlex, Kathy Overton has authored 16 papers receiving a total of 527 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Ecology, 7 papers in Immunology and 5 papers in Oceanography. Recurrent topics in Kathy Overton's work include Parasite Biology and Host Interactions (10 papers), Aquaculture disease management and microbiota (7 papers) and Marine Bivalve and Aquaculture Studies (4 papers). Kathy Overton is often cited by papers focused on Parasite Biology and Host Interactions (10 papers), Aquaculture disease management and microbiota (7 papers) and Marine Bivalve and Aquaculture Studies (4 papers). Kathy Overton collaborates with scholars based in Australia and Norway. Kathy Overton's co-authors include Tim Dempster, Frode Oppedal, Lars Helge Stien, Tore Kristiansen, Kristine Gismervik, Luke T. Barrett, Samantha Bui, Stephen E. Swearer, Francisca Samsing and Andrew Coates and has published in prestigious journals such as Conservation Biology, Journal of Applied Ecology and Biological Conservation.
